Return to Portfolio

The Infinite Menu

Discover, plan, cook, and manage — one platform for every kitchen decision.

Try the App

What is The Infinite Menu

A comprehensive web-based kitchen management platform that transforms how users discover, organize, and manage their culinary lives — combining intelligent recipe search, meal planning, inventory tracking, and personal collections in one unified experience.

60% Meal Planning Time Saved
40% Reduction in Food Waste
15+ Dietary Filters
500K+ Recipes Integrated

Problem & Opportunity

73% of consumers struggle with weekly meal planning. The market is fragmented across single-purpose apps that don't talk to each other.

Pain Points

  • Meal Planning Complexity — Excessive time spent on food decisions every single week
  • Recipe Discovery Friction — 20+ minutes finding recipes that match dietary needs
  • Inventory Blindness — 68% of households lack pantry tracking, leading to waste and overbuying
  • Fragmented Tools — Users juggle 3–4 apps for recipes, planning, lists, and inventory

Our Answer

  • Unified Platform — Recipe discovery, meal planning, inventory, and collections in one place
  • 15+ Dietary Filters — Advanced search by cuisine, time, calories, restrictions
  • Smart Inventory — Multi-location tracking with expiry alerts and auto-deduction
  • AI Suggestions — Personality-driven recommendations that use what you already have
$12.2B Total Addressable Market
$3.8B Serviceable Market
23% CAGR (2024–2029)

Five Core Modules

🔍

Recipe Discovery Engine

Advanced search with 15+ dietary filters, smart filtering by cuisine, cooking time, and calories. AI-powered personality-driven recommendations via Spoonacular API.

📅

Meal Planning System

Weekly calendar with drag-and-drop scheduling, multi-meal support per day, serving management, and nutritional analytics across 7-day cycles.

📦

Smart Inventory

Multi-location tracking for fridge, freezer, and pantry. Expiry monitoring with visual alerts and automatic ingredient deduction when cooking.

💡

AI Suggestions

Inventory-aware recommendation engine that factors dietary preferences, meal history, and what's about to expire into every suggestion.

📚

Personal Collections

Color-coded organization, favorites system, social sharing, and unified search across personal and platform recipes.

Intelligent Recipe Discovery

500K+ Recipes, Your Way

The discovery engine integrates with Spoonacular's API to surface 500,000+ recipes filtered through the most comprehensive set of dietary and preference controls available in any kitchen app. AI-powered personality-driven suggestions go beyond keyword matching to recommend dishes that fit your habits and mood.

  • 15+ dietary filters including allergens, intolerances, and diet types
  • Filter by cuisine, cooking time, calorie range, and ingredients on hand
  • AI personality-driven recommendations that learn from usage patterns
  • Guardian News API integration for food culture content and inspiration
  • Unified search across platform and personal recipe collections
Recipe search results with active dietary filters and AI suggestion cards.

Smart Inventory

Track Everything, Waste Nothing

The inventory system tracks ingredients across fridge, freezer, and pantry — with expiry date monitoring that surfaces visual alerts before food goes bad. When you cook a recipe, ingredients are automatically deducted. The recommendation engine uses inventory state to prioritize recipes that use what you have.

  • Multi-location tracking: refrigerator, freezer, pantry
  • Expiry date monitoring with color-coded visual alerts
  • Automatic ingredient deduction when cooking recipes
  • Inventory-aware recipe suggestions prioritize expiring items
  • Designed to reduce household food waste by 35–45%
Inventory dashboard with expiry alerts and location-based organization.

Meal Planning

Your Week, Organized

The weekly calendar interface makes meal planning visual and effortless. Drag and drop recipes into any day, manage servings per meal, and track nutritional totals across the entire 7-day cycle — turning the most tedious kitchen task into something that takes minutes.

  • Drag-and-drop weekly calendar interface
  • Multi-meal support per day (breakfast, lunch, dinner, snacks)
  • Serving size management per meal
  • Nutritional analytics across the full 7-day cycle
  • 60% reduction in time spent on weekly meal planning
Weekly meal calendar with drag-and-drop recipes and nutrition summary.

Technical Architecture

Backend
Python Flask 3.0.2
SQLAlchemy ORM, 5 specialized service layers, RESTful architecture
Database
SQLite / PostgreSQL
11 interconnected models, SQLite (dev), PostgreSQL (prod)
Frontend
HTML5 + Bootstrap 5
Responsive, mobile-first CSS3/JS with modern UI patterns
Auth
Flask-Login
Secure password hashing, session management, user data protection
APIs
Spoonacular + Guardian
500K+ recipes, food culture content, RESTful integration
Services
5 Modular Layers
Recipe, Inventory, Storage, Suggestion, and User services

Experience Flow

From craving to clean kitchen — six integrated steps.

01

Recipe Discovery

Search 500K+ recipes with dietary filters, cuisine, and AI suggestions.

02

Meal Planning

Drag-and-drop into a weekly calendar with nutritional analytics.

03

Inventory Check

Smart pantry tracking with expiry alerts across all locations.

04

Smart Suggestions

AI recommends recipes based on what you have and what's expiring.

05

Cook & Deduct

Ingredients auto-deducted from inventory when you cook.

06

Collect & Share

Save favorites to color-coded collections and share with family.

Who It Serves

Sarah, 32
Busy Professional

Limited time for meal planning and grocery shopping.

→ 3 hours/week saved in planning and shopping

The Johnson Family
Health-Conscious

Managing dietary restrictions across family members.

→ 25% improvement in nutritional balance

Marcus, 28
Culinary Enthusiast

Recipe discovery and organization of favorites.

→ 40% increase in recipe variety

Emma, 22
Budget-Conscious Student

Minimizing food waste on a tight budget.

→ 30% waste reduction, $150/month savings

Competitive Analysis

Platform Recipe Search Meal Planning Inventory Collections Unified
The Infinite Menu ✓ Advanced ✓ Full ✓ Smart ✓ Personal ✓ Complete
Paprika ✓ Basic ✗ Limited ✗ Minimal ✓ Basic
PlateJoy ✗ Limited ✓ Focused ✗ None ✗ None
BigOven ✓ Good ✗ Basic ✗ None ✓ Basic
Key Differentiators: Only platform combining all four core functions. Most comprehensive dietary filtering. Unique inventory-to-recipe intelligence loop. Single subscription replaces 3–4 specialized apps.

Success Indicators

User Engagement

65% DAU target, 12-min average sessions, 95% recipe search adoption, 78% meal planning usage.

Business Impact

35–45% food waste reduction, 60% planning efficiency gain, 3× recipe variety, $200/month household savings.

Technical Performance

<500ms API response, 92% search accuracy, 95+ Lighthouse mobile score, 99.9% uptime target.

User Satisfaction

70+ NPS target, 4.5+ feature satisfaction, 85% retention after 3 months.

Note: Metrics represent targets based on user testing and competitive benchmarks. Production analytics will validate these figures as the user base scales.

Implementation Roadmap

Phase 1: Foundation

Completed
  • User authentication & sessions
  • Basic recipe search
  • Database architecture (11 models)
  • Responsive web interface

Phase 2: Core Features

Completed
  • Meal planning calendar system
  • Recipe collections management
  • User dashboard & analytics
  • Inventory management foundation

Phase 3: Intelligence

Current
  • Recipe recommendation engine
  • Inventory-based suggestions
  • Advanced analytics & insights
  • Mobile optimization

Conclusion

The Infinite Menu represents a paradigm shift in kitchen management — addressing fragmented user experiences with a unified, intelligent platform. By combining recipe discovery, meal planning, inventory management, and personal collections in a single solution, the platform delivers measurable value through reduced food waste, improved nutrition, and significant time savings.

With proven user engagement models, measurable impact metrics, and a clear roadmap toward AI-driven intelligence, The Infinite Menu is positioned to become the definitive platform for modern kitchen management — transforming kitchens from spaces of complexity and waste into centers of efficiency, health, and culinary discovery.

Unified Platform
AI-Powered Discovery
Smart Inventory
Meal Planning
Technical Excellence
Market Ready